Transaction d531170939e420f31148de210b122df2136f7a078bac43fcc4e84ac8220e671e
1 Input
1 Output
-
d531170939e420f31148de210b122df2136f7a078bac43fcc4e84ac8220e671e:0
- value
- 5096520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af5be0f40d9177430725915d6bc624e4a8d7c2e9 OP_EQUAL
- address
- 3HgEExcoFNapDxG1PUSxiyZLiuh73hwjbC